T. Rowe Price Investment Management Inc. trimmed its holdings in Voya Financial, Inc. (NYSE:VOYA - Free Report) by 11.5% in the first qu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 692,166 shares of the asset manager's stock after selling 90,377 shares during the quarter. T. Rowe Price Investment Management Inc. owned about 0.72% of Voya Financial worth $46,902,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Voya Financial (NYSE:VOYA -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Tuesday, August 5th. The asset manager reported $2.40 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.09 by $0.31. The business had revenue of $1.98 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$1.94 billion. Voya Financial had a return on equity of 13.72% and a net margin of 6.73%.Voya Financial's revenue was down 2.6%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$2.18 earnings per share. Equities analysts anticipate that Voya Financial, Inc. will post 8.39 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Voya Financial Announces Dividend
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, September 26th.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, August 26th will be paid a dividend of $0.45 per share.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, August 26th. This represents a $1.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.4%. Voya Financial's payout ratio is currently 36.00%.

Voya Financial Company Profile
(
Free Report)
Voya Financial, Inc engages in the provision of workplace benefits and savings products in the United States and internationally. The company operates through three segments: Wealth Solutions, Health Solutions, and Investment Management. The Wealth Solutions segment offers full-service retirement products; recordkeeping services; stable value and fixed general account investment products; non-qualified plan administration services; and tools, guidance, and services to promote the financial well-being and retirement security of employees.
